摘要
We studied the applications of the anomaly sum rule (ASR) to the transition form factors of light pseudoscalar mesons: pi(0), eta and eta '. This nonperturbative QCD approach can be used even if the QCD factorization is broken. The status of possible small non-OPE corrections to continuum in comparison to BaBar and Belle data is explored. The accuracy of the applied method and the role of the quark mass contributions are discussed.
